## Tuning the image cache

The Thornquay image cache leaks memory when eviction falls behind decode throughput; resident size grows until the pod is OOM-killed, typically overnight. On-call mitigation: restart the cache pods, then tighten eviction until the fix in Driftbow 2.4 lands. Watch the `cache_resident_bytes` panel; steady growth over 30 minutes means eviction has stalled again. Do not raise the max entry count—that only delays the kill. Eviction cadence, size ceilings, and TTLs are controlled by the constants below.

limits module of fajog-tawig:
RATE_LIMITS = {
    "druwyn": 2,
    "quenael": 10,
    "wenix": 2,
    "druael": 2,
}

# Fennelcast Queue — Environments

Quick notes for the security review: log compaction runs hourly in prod and daily in staging, which is why staging retains deleted payloads way longer than you'd expect. Keep that in mind when checking data-retention claims. Compaction settings differ per environment; the production ones are below.

deployment values, hahip-kajep:
HOLAX_PIN=4003
HOLAX_METRICS_HOST=metrics.holax.zemvarworks.internal
HOLAX_LOG_LEVEL=warn
HOLAX_TENANT=fraael

Onboarding note for release managers at Corvall Systems: the cron drift investigation (project Tickmire) tracks why scheduled jobs on the Halwyn fleet slip by up to ninety seconds after daylight transitions. Findings live in the drift ledger; always review the ledger before approving a release that touches scheduler code. The ledger service requires re-authentication every thirty days, and if your session has expired during an incident, unlock it with the recovery passphrase kept on file, shown immediately below.

strongbox words: istwyn-normir-silwyn-ulaius-istwyn

Handover: ScaleWright calculator

Unit conversion tables live in `core/units.ts`; the fraction-rounding logic is in `round.ts` and has known quirks with thirds. Don't touch the yield-adjustment math without running the golden tests. Deploys go through the Brindle pipeline, nothing special. Full architecture notes, open bugs, and the deprecation plan for v1 are on the internal wiki page below.

operations page: https://jenkins.zemvarcloud.local/job/merge_requests/repo/build/73930b4b30f0a8ed